package org.springframework.context.event;
import java.util.HashSet;
import java.util.Iterator;
import java.util.Set;
import org.springframework.context.ApplicationEvent;
import org.springframework.context.ApplicationListener;
/**
* Concrete implementation of ApplicationEventMulticaster
* Doesn't permit multiple instances of the same listener.
*
* <p>Note that this class doesn't try to do anything clever to ensure thread
* safety if listeners are added or removed at runtime. A technique such as
* Copy-on-Write (Lea:137) could be used to ensure this, but the assumption in
* this version of this framework is that listeners will be added at application
* configuration time and not added or removed as the application runs.
*
* <p>All listeners are invoked in the calling thread. This allows the danger of
* a rogue listener blocking the entire application, but adds minimal overhead.
*
* <p>An alternative implementation could be more sophisticated in both these respects.
*
* @author Rod Johnson
*/
public class ApplicationEventMulticasterImpl implements ApplicationEventMulticaster {
/** Set of listeners */
private Set eventListeners = new HashSet();
public void addApplicationListener(ApplicationListener l) {
eventListeners.add(l);
}
public void removeApplicationListener(ApplicationListener l) {
eventListeners.remove(l);
}
public void onApplicationEvent(ApplicationEvent e) {
Iterator i = eventListeners.iterator();
while (i.hasNext()) {
ApplicationListener l = (ApplicationListener) i.next();
l.onApplicationEvent(e);
}
}
public void removeAllListeners() {
eventListeners.clear();
}
}
